Sherre Hirsch is a rabbi, author, & spirituality expert. She currently serves full time as the Global Head of Integrated Wellness for Hillel International. Her mission is to empower individuals become more in tune with their well-being, way of life and ability to impact the world. After eight years in the pulpit, Hirsch left Sinai Temple, Los Angeles’s largest and oldest conservative synagogue. Since then, she has published with Random House We Plan, God Laughs: What to Do When Life Hits You Over the Head a top 100 in all books and Thresholds: How to Thrive Through Life’s Transitions to Live Fearlessly and Regret-Free –a Vanity Fair “Best Type”. Hirsch served as spirituality expert for The Today Show and numerous other media outlets. She counsels private clients, speaks nationwide at engagements for corporate and religious organizations, and teaches classes across a variety of themes. Hirsch is the Spiritual Life consultant for Canyon Ranch Properties, where she organizes retreats and leads workshops focused on coping with grief and the healing process. She is married to Dr. Jeffrey Hirsch and resides in Los Angeles with her four children and rescued dog, Latke.
